Designed a dashboard concept for tracking net worth across every asset type — stocks, crypto, property, pensions, funds, cash, and liabilities — all in one place.
Instead of the usual pie chart or bar graph, the centerpiece is a dial: a single, glanceable gauge showing where your wealth actually sits. Behind it, a quiet grid of every asset category fades in and out of visibility, reinforcing that everything's accounted for even when it's not the focus.
Dark UI, a single confident green accent, and a lot of negative space — built to make a genuinely overwhelming task (seeing your entire financial picture at once) feel calm instead of cluttered.
Receiving feedback is not the same as having permission to publish it.
That distinction shaped ReviewDesk, a customer feedback and testimonial system I designed and built at Noerong.
For a local business, the workflow starts after a completed job: request honest feedback, keep track of the response, and make the next step clear.
Three decisions shaped the experience:
1. Keep the customer journey focused.
A branded page and private request link make it clear where to respond. Scheduled reminders stop after a response.
2. Separate feedback from public proof.
Testimonial consent and administrator approval are distinct steps. Every rating receives the same public-review option, without filtering out unhappy customers.
3. Give the business a useful overview.
The dashboard brings requests, responses, activity, and approval status together. Approved testimonials can appear on a public wall or an embeddable website widget.
I designed and developed the customer flow, dashboard, reminder worker, and widget using Python and FastAPI.
The loop shows the feedback page, business dashboard, and testimonial wall. All customer names, comments, and metrics are fictional demo data. The public demo sends no email and retains no visitor submissions.
The detail I care about most: permission is part of the product, not an afterthought.
